Clarence Stuart “Clancy” Place, “Unc” to family, passed away Thursday, September 17, 2020 at Waukesha Memorial Hospital at the age of 83. Clarence was born on April 3, 1937 in Davenport, IA to Harry and Sarah (Larson) Place.
Clancy served in the US Army National Guard for 7+ years. He then worked for General Castings, Reinhardt Food Service and later retired and enjoyed his employment and time at Genesee Market. Clancy was a longtime member of the 1st Congregational Church of Genesee. He enjoyed cooking, gardening, camping, traveling, fishing and his card club and the friends he made there. Clancy enjoyed his Friday night fish fries. To Unc, his nieces and nephews were his children. He loved them completely.
Clancy is preceded in death by his parents; his 2 brothers, George “Sonny” and Warren; his sister, Doris and an infant sister Mary.
Survivors include his sister Marian Reeves, his numerous nieces, nephews, great and great- great nieces and nephews, other family and a host of friends that will all miss him tremendously.
